Google! Oh and by the way you can still get the breakout of vehicle sales. There are many proxies to know this information.

ie. when you register a vehicle with with the DMV it doesn't say could be an x, s or perhaps even a semi. It will specifically say which vehicle.

If an autoparts supplier ships say 20k pieces of a part to Tesla which is a specific piece to only that vehicle like a windshield or something...then it's safe to say Tesla built 20k of said vehicle.
Vehicle registrations is the closest proxy to how many they sold. It does omit those that are bought for use on things like farms and factories or that are exported (e.g. to places like Saudi Arabia). It also doesn't count those that are sold to governments since those aren't registered through DMVs.

Parts is an OK proxy but there are also extras bought for testing, repairs, and failures. And manufacturers, even in these days of lean manufacturing, will always have some number of parts in stock which can distort the quarterly numbers - in either direction.

So yes, you can get a "pretty close" number from combining the the above. Which is why it's baffling to me that Tesla tries to keep the actual number secret by not breaking it out.
